In this episode of This Is Stand-Up, Village Voice contributor Jessica Pilot sits down with comedian Patton Oswalt at Frank’s Barber Boutique in Los Angeles to talk about the responsibilities comedians have — especially in a world where performers in the public eye are being scrutinized more than ever.
Oswalt says it’s essential that “comedians remain as irresponsible as we can in terms of mockery and language.” He also addresses the so-called “PC police” and “social-justice warriors,” and how their outrage helps prove that comedy is a crucial part of culture today.
“It’s become very, very clear over the past three decades that comedy is pretty fucking essential,” Oswalt tells the Voice.
